**Position Summary**

**As an HR Coordinator, your key accountabilities will involve**:

- Attend job fairs and careers events with the recruitment team
- Ensuring all onboard paperwork is reviewed and processed guaranteeing a smooth transition for new hires.
- Coordinate and schedule comprehensive first-day meetings for new employees to facilitate seamless integration into our work environment.
- Assist with managing updates on BambooHR to maintain accurate and up-to-date employee records.
- Assist in the preparation and distribution of basic standard letters, including employment verifications
- Assist with the administration of employee programs, including benefits, wellness program, and service awards
- Assist with ensuring compliance with labor laws and regulations
- Assist with employee engagement events

**As an HR Coordinator your experience and qualifications will include**:

- Degree in Human Resources or Business Administration, or completion of HR Management program
- 1-2 years of experience in HR or a related role
- Demonstrate strong organizational skills with the ability to manage multiple tasks
- Exceptional communication and interpersonal skills
- Familiar with recruitment processes, onboarding, and employee relations
- Proficient in HR Information Systems (HRIS) and Microsoft Office
- Familiarity with social media, especially LinkedIn
- Possess a comprehensive understanding of HR policies, procedures, and regulations.
- Strong ability in problem-solving with the ability to address employee queries and concerns
- Ability to work collaboratively in a team environment
